The Skechers Slip‑Ins Mark Nason Street Wave Hiway Women’s blends effortless step‑in convenience with a sleek, fashion‑forward design inspired by modern streetwear. Built with Skechers’ signature Slip‑Ins® technology, this elevated sneaker delivers hands‑free functionality with a secure, comfortable fit—perfect for busy days, travel, or everyday style that doesn’t slow you down.
The engineered knit upper creates a smooth, flexible feel with a refined silhouette that pairs easily with casual outfits or athleisure looks. Fixed stretch laces allow the shoe to open and flex as you step in, while the exclusive Heel Pillow™ design gently supports your heel to keep your foot comfortably in place without bending down or adjusting laces.
Inside, the Luxe Foam® insole provides soft, supportive cushioning that keeps you comfortable through long days on your feet. The lightweight midsole adds responsive shock absorption and a smooth, easy stride, while the flexible rubber traction outsole offers reliable grip on sidewalks, store floors, and everyday surfaces.
